Linux上快速安装MySQL RPM包教程

linux安装mysql的rpm

时间:2025-07-13 22:58


Linux系统上安装MySQL RPM包的全面指南 在当今的信息技术领域中,MySQL作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性和易用性,成为了众多企业和开发者的首选

    无论是在Web应用、数据分析还是企业级解决方案中,MySQL都发挥着举足轻重的作用

    本文将详细介绍如何在Linux系统上通过RPM包安装MySQL,确保每一步都清晰明了,让您轻松上手

     一、准备工作 在安装MySQL之前,有几个关键的准备工作需要做好,以确保安装过程顺利进行: 1.系统检查: - 确认您的Linux发行版支持RPM包管理(如CentOS、RHEL、Fedora等)

     - 检查系统架构(如x86_64),以便下载对应版本的RPM包

     2.用户权限: - 安装MySQL通常需要root权限,因此您可能需要使用`sudo`命令或以root用户身份登录

     3.网络连接: - 确保您的Linux系统可以访问互联网,以便从MySQL官方网站或官方仓库下载RPM包

     4.依赖项检查: - 虽然RPM包管理器会自动处理大部分依赖关系,但预先检查并安装必要的库(如libaio)可以避免安装过程中的潜在问题

     二、下载MySQL RPM包 MySQL提供了多种安装途径,包括直接从官方网站下载RPM包、使用MySQL官方的Yum仓库等

    这里我们推荐通过MySQL官方的Yum仓库进行安装,因为它可以自动处理依赖关系,并方便后续的更新和维护

     1.添加MySQL Yum仓库: - 首先,您需要下载MySQL Yum仓库的配置文件

    访问MySQL官方网站,找到适用于您Linux发行版的仓库设置命令

     - 以CentOS7为例,可以使用以下命令添加MySQL8.0的Yum仓库: bash sudo yum localinstall https://dev.mysql.com/get/mysql80-community-release-el7-5.noarch.rpm 2.验证仓库添加成功: - 执行`yum repolist enabled | grep mysql`命令,检查MySQL仓库是否已成功启用

     三、安装MySQL Server 有了正确的Yum仓库配置后,安装MySQL Server就变得非常简单了

     1.执行安装命令: - 使用`yum install`命令来安装MySQL Server: bash sudo yum install mysql-community-server 2.安装过程中的提示: - 安装过程中,Yum会提示您确认安装以及处理依赖关系

    一般情况下,直接按提示操作即可

     3.验证安装: - 安装完成后,您可以通过`rpm -qa | grep mysql`命令检查已安装的MySQL相关RPM包

     四、启动并配置MySQL服务 安装完成后,接下来是启动MySQL服务并进行一些基本配置

     1.启动MySQL服务: - 使用`systemctl`命令启动MySQL服务: bash sudo systemctl start mysqld 2.设置开机自启: - 为了确保MySQL在系统重启后自动启动,可以将其设置为开机自启: bash sudo systemctl enable mysqld 3.获取临时root密码: - 在MySQL5.7及更高版本中,安装完成后会在`/var/log/mysqld.log`文件中生成一个临时的root密码

    使用以下命令查找并显示该密码: bash sudo grep temporary password /var/log/mysqld.log 4.安全配置MySQL: - 使用找到的临时密码登录MySQL,并执行`mysql_secure_installation`脚本来设置新的root密码、移除匿名用户、禁止root远程登录等安全操作: bash mysql_secure_installation 五、配置MySQL客户端 虽然MySQL服务已经运行,但为了方便管理,您可能还需要配置MySQL客户端工具

     1.安装MySQL客户端: - 如果MySQL客户端没有随服务器一起安装,可以通过以下命令安装: bash sudo yum install mysql 2.配置环境变量: - 为了方便在任何目录下使用`mysql`命令,可以将MySQL的bin目录添加到系统的PATH环境变量中

    编辑`/etc/profile`或用户的`~/.bashrc`文件,添加如下行: bash export PATH=$PATH:/usr/bin/mysql - 之后,使用`source`命令使改动生效: bash source ~/.bashrc 六、测试MySQL连接 最后,通过简单的测试来验证MySQL是否正确安装并配置成功

     1.使用mysql命令登录: - 使用新设置的root密码登录MySQL: bash mysql -u root -p 2.执行简单查询: - 登录后,执行一个简单的SQL查询,如查看数据库列表: sql SHOW DATABASES; 3.退出MySQL命令行: - 测试完成后,输入`exit`退出MySQL命令行界面

     七、后续维护与更新 安装MySQL只是第一步,后续的维护与更新同样重要

     1.定期更新: - 使用`yum update`命令定期检查并更新MySQL及其依赖项

     2.备份与恢复: - 定期备份数据库,以防数据丢失

    MySQL提供了多种备份工具,如`mysqldump`

     3.监控与优化: - 使用系统监控工具和MySQL自带的性能监控功能,定期检查数据库性能,进行必要的优化

     结语 通过本文的详细步骤,您应该能够在Linux系统上顺利安装并配置MySQL

    无论是对于初学者还是有一定经验的系统管理员,掌握这些基本技能都将为您的数据库管理工作打下坚实的基础

    MySQL作为一款强大的数据库系统,其功能和性能的优化空间巨大,希望本文能成为您深入学习MySQL的起点

    随着技术的不断进步,持续关注MySQL的更新和新特性,将帮助您更好地应对各种数据库管理挑战